Mayurbhanj: A woman allegedly killed his husband over family dispute at Mahulapanga village under Kaptipada police limits in Mayurbhanj district on Tuesday night.
The deceased has been identified as Tuna Besra and the accused as Champa Besra.
According to sources, the couple had a heated argument over some family issues on Tuesday night, following they started attacking each other. Later, Champa hit her hubby with a stone.
Locals spotted the couple lying in a pool of blood and took them to Kaptipada hospital. Doctor declared Tuna brought dead.
On being informed, police reached the spot and started investigation.
